- More about COVID-19 Pandemic, India and the World: Economic and Social Policy Perspectives
The book analyzes the economic and social impact of the Covid-19 crisis with a special focus on India, examining the economic disruption, policy responses, and the prospect of a severe global recession. It also covers the suffering of the masses, affected socio-cultural relationships, behavioral patterns, and psychological attitudes. The essays discuss key themes such as the changing global economy, public health policy failures, the impact on education, agriculture, industry, firms, households, and the informal sector. The volume includes original research by leading economists from India and abroad and will be useful for scholars and researchers in economics, Indian economy, development economics, development studies, labor studies, public policy, public administration, governance, sociology, and political economy.

The COVID-19 pandemic has had a profound impact on the world economy and society, with India being no exception. This book delves into the economic and social consequences of the crisis, with a special focus on India. It examines the devastating economic disruption caused by the pandemic, the various policy responses implemented by the government, and the potential for a severe global recession. Furthermore, it explores the profound suffering experienced by the masses and the significant disruptions to socio-cultural relationships, behavioral patterns, and psychological attitudes governing human interaction.
The essays in this volume cover a wide range of topics, including:
The Corona pandemic and the changing global economy: The book examines the impact of the pandemic on global economic growth, trade, and macroeconomic recovery. It explores the challenges and opportunities that countries have faced in navigating this unprecedented crisis.
Public health and policy failures: The essays analyze the public health response to the pandemic and identify the policy failures that have contributed to its severity. It examines the role of governments, healthcare systems, and international organizations in addressing the crisis.
Appropriate policy response: The book discusses the appropriate policy responses to the pandemic, including measures such as lockdowns, economic stimulus packages, and social safety nets. It examines the effectiveness of these measures and the challenges that they have posed.
Impact on education: The pandemic has disrupted education systems worldwide, and this book explores the impact on India's education sector. It examines the challenges faced by students, teachers, and educational institutions and provides guidelines for the future.
Idea of economic herd immunity: The book discusses the concept of economic herd immunity and its implications for the pandemic. It examines the role of vaccination programs in ending the pandemic and the challenges that India faces in achieving herd immunity.
Impact of India's lockdown, crisis of the migrant laborers: The book explores the impact of India's lockdown on the country's economy, particularly on the migrant laborers who are the backbone of the informal sector. It examines the challenges faced by these workers and the government's response to their crisis.
Impact on agriculture, industry, firms, households, and the informal sector: The pandemic has had a significant impact on various sectors of the Indian economy, including agriculture, industry, and the informal sector. The book examines the challenges and opportunities that these sectors have faced and provides insights into the future of these industries.
Implications of digital technology for production, labor, and labor relations: The pandemic has accelerated the adoption of digital technology in various industries, and this book explores the implications of this technology for production, labor, and labor relations. It examines the potential benefits and challenges of automation and digitalization.
Violence amidst the virus: The pandemic has also led to increased violence and social unrest, particularly in India. The book examines the COVID-19 and Hindu-Muslim conflict in India, domestic violence, questions of occupation, identity, gender, and vulnerability. It explores the social and political factors that have contributed to these issues and provides recommendations for addressing them.
De-globalization and environmental challenges in the post-COVID era: The pandemic has highlighted the interconnectedness of the world economy and the importance of sustainable development. The book examines the de-globalization trends that have emerged in the post-COVID era and the environmental challenges that countries face. It explores the potential for sustainable economic growth and the role of governments and international organizations in promoting sustainable development.
